WebTogether with the population boom, Bayraklı Mound became insufficient for people of İzmir with its 100 decare area; so a new city of İzmir was built at the mountain foot of Pagos around 300 BC. The historian Strabo was saying that İzmir was the most beautiful Ionian city in his time, that is to say in the early 1st century BC.
